Zanzibar, an archipelago from the coast of Tanzania, is actually a aspiration spot for vacationers in search of an unforgettable island encounter. The pristine beaches, turquoise waters, loaded cultural heritage, and numerous wildlife help it become a really perfect spot for many who really like adventure, peace, and cultural exploration. Discoveri